Where Landmark's grants concentrate

Landmark Graphics Corporation is a focused PatentsView assignee: 42 CPC subclasses with 67.3% of grants classified under E21B (Earth OR Rock DRILLING; Obtaining OIL, GAS, Water, Soluble OR Meltable Materials OR A Slurry OF Minerals From Wells). Peak complete grant year is 2019 (78 grants) versus a trough of 19 in 2015. By volume, Landmark sits between Caterpillar Paving Products Inc. and Adeia Guides Inc..

Landmark's three-year grant acceleration

From 2019–2021 to 2022–2024, Landmark Graphics Corporation moved from 149 to 158 grants (1.06x the prior three-year total, a multiple, not a CAGR). Among 3,296 tracked assignees with ≥100 grants and ≥20 prior-period grants, that multiple ranks #1,040. See the growth leaderboard.

Landmark Graphics Corporation patent grants by year, 2015–2025
Year Patents Granted Share of Period
2015 19 4.0%
2016 30 6.3%
2017 40 8.4%
2018 53 11.2%
2019 78 16.5%
2020 39 8.2%
2021 32 6.8%
2022 56 11.8%
2023 53 11.2%
2024 49 10.3%
2025partial year 25 5.3%
